    I’m trying to post blogs on two websites i’m running. I want the blog to match the look and colors of my website, and I want the blog to be running off of my website, not externally linked to some other blogging site (i.e. blogspot, blogger.com). Also, i need blogging program where somebody can just log onto the website, enter a username and password, and post their blog Are there any blogging programs (free or for purchase, free preffered) where i can do this?

    blogger.com will actually let you host the blog on your site and you can do whatever you want with it there (or on their server, too – just edit the templates, although there you still will have the bar across the top)…if you host it on your site, you just need to set up an ftp account on your box and put it in the settings on blogger.com and they will ftp the blog content to your site whenever you tell them too (like when you post)…just make sure that account has very limited access to the blog dir only.

    alternately, there’s a tool like word press – mysql and php and free for download: https://wordpress.org/
